Bitcoin's Influence on Capital Distribution and Cooperative Action

The chapter explores the influence of Bitcoin on capital distribution and human action, highlighting its potential to redirect human behavior towards cooperation and away from coercion. The speakers discuss the importance of strong private property rights, the violation of which occurs through money printing and fiat regulation. They advocate for a shift towards a system that promotes consensual trade and productivity for a more peaceful society.
